[[Ork]] '''Stormboyz''' are the equivalent of greenskin shock troops. They have discipline above that of the average Ork and are more efficient too. Commonly viewed as being nutcases amongst regular Orks since they go into battle with fuel-filled rockets strapped to their backs. Orks usually distrust anything that flies and prefer to go to battle on their own two legs, but Stormboyz love nothing more than joining battle quickly, part of the reason they strap rockets to their backs.{{Fn|1}}
Most Stormboyz are usually [[Ork Boyz|younger Orks]] who for various, inexplicable reasons, have grown tired of the normaly normally anarchic lifestyle among the regular Ork boyz. Tired of being told that they can do whatever they want they seek the way to rebel against typical Ork lifestyle. Longing for discipline, these youths often run off to join a Stormboyz camp. This is particularly typical of the youths of the [[Goffs]] and [[Blood Axe]] [[Ork Clans|clans]].{{Fn|1}}
While at these camps the young Orks are drilled in marching and hurtling through the air, a regimental lifestyle that these Orks can become easily addicted to. It may be due to their chosen lifestyle that Ork Stormboyz have an actual respect for authority rare in [[Ork Culture|Ork Kultur]]. Unlike most Orks, Stormboyz also take planning and forethought very seriously. Such information as strength and location of the foe are used by the Stormboyz to determine how best to orchestrate their attack.{{Fn|1}}
